On this week's Gossip Girl, the whole gang goes on a field trip to Yale to try to impress the dean and secure admissions. Because suddenly, Yale is the school everyone (save for Jenny and Vanessa) dreams of attending. Dan and Nate conveniently gave up on their previously chosen schools for various reasons, and after a tongue-lashing from Blair about how Brown is "an enclave of trustifarians" and dreadlocked hippies, Serena decides Yale is the place for her, too.

You guys, Gossip Girl is so freaking fun right now. This season is starting off with a bang, don't you think? Last night everyone was back, including Rufus from his band tour, Jenny from playing in the Hamptons with Eric, and Vanessa who has been watching the gallery and decorating it and turning it into a cafe or something.
